Does anyone have a choke assembly for the stock carb?

Gorilla hands got the better of me and I cracked the plastic threaded piece today.

From what I can tell, you can't just replace that piece. The entire choke cable is all one piece.

Figured I would check here before I shell out $60+ for a new one.
